- The distance between Alexandra, New Zealand and Tulsa, Ok, Usa is approximately 13,097 km or 8,139 mi.
- To reach Alexandra in this distance one would set out from Tulsa, Ok bearing 232.5°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Alexandra bearing 245.4° or WSW .
- Alexandra has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Tulsa, Ok has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Alexandra is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Tulsa, Ok is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 5.2 °C (9.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.7 °C (21.1°F) less in Alexandra.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 696 mm (27.4 in) less which is equivalent to 696 l/m² (17.08 US gal/ft²) or 6,960,000 l/ha (744,070 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.7° lower in Alexandra than in Tulsa, Ok.
